Trộn dung dịch chứa Ba2+, OH- 0,06mol và Na+ 0,02mol với dung dịch HCO3- 0,04mol, CO3 2- 0,03mol và Na+. Tính khối lượng kết tủa thu được sau phản ứng. Giúp mình với ạ, mình đọc đề mà không biết hướng làm cho lắm

2 câu trả lời

Theo ĐLBT ĐT có: dung dịch chứa Ba2+ 0,02 mol, OH- 0,06 mol và Na+ 0,02 mol với dung dịch chứa HCO3- 0,04 mol ; CO32- 0,03 mol và Na+ 0,1 mol

HCO3-+ OH-→ CO32-+ H2O

0,04      0,06     0,04 mol

Ba2++ CO32-→ BaCO3

0,02    0,07      0,02       mol

suy ra mBaCO3 = 0,02.197 = 3,94 gam

Đáp án:

 

Giải thích các bước giải:

Tính số mol Ba2+

BTDT:2nBa2++nNa+=nOH−

- Tính nCO32−

 HCO3− + OH− → CO32− + H2O

=> nCO32−

- Tính nBaCO3

So sánh nCO32− và nBa2+

cho mình xin câu trả lời hay nhất

Câu hỏi trong lớp Xem thêm